How they compare

Madagascar currently reports 1.58 trillion current LCU against 390.89 billion current LCU in South Africa, a difference of 1.19 trillion current LCU.

That makes Madagascar's figure about 4.0 times South Africa's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 24 shared years of data; in 1986 it was South Africa ahead.

Madagascar ranks 4th and South Africa ranks 7th of 26 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Madagascar averaged higher in 2 and South Africa in 1.

Private sector’s gross domestic saving is derived as value added in private sector at factor cost less private consumption, etc. Data are in current local currency.
